Been working from home (small 1 bedroom apt I share with my SO) for a couple months now. Started out on the couch but quickly realized how much pain it was causing in my neck and back. Wish I had room for a desk and real office chair but I don't.
Now I use a wireless keyboard and mouse and switch back and forth between having my laptop on a stand (https://smile.amazon.com/gp/aw/d/B01HHYQBB8?psc=1&ref=ppx_pop_mob_b_asin_title) to keep it at eye level while working from the dining table, and using my TV as a monitor while sitting the couch and using my lift top coffee table (https://smile.amazon.com/gp/aw/d/B0744B7PTW?psc=1&ref=ppx_pop_mob_b_asin_title) as a work surface.
